| What are Cookies and How Does our Websites Use Them? We may use "cookies" to collect or log certain information. A cookie is a small piece of information that a website stores on a personal computer and which it can later retrieve. We may use cookies for some administrative purposes, for example, to store our customers' preferences for certain kinds of products or to store a password so that you do not have to input it every time you visit our website. The cookies will not contain information that will enable anyone to contact our customers via telephone, email, or any other means. If our customers are uncomfortable with the use of cookie technology, they can set their browsers to refuse cookies. Certain of our services, however, could be dependent on cookies and our customers may disable those services by refusing cookies. |
